WitrynaThe mbira is a traditional instrument of the Shona People often used in religious ceremonies. There are several different varieties of mbira including the mbira … Witryna30 sie 2024 · While simple instruments with 6-10 tines are found widely in sub-Saharan Africa, the Shona people in present-day Zimbabwe created the mbira zdavazdimu, the “big mbira of the ancestral spirits”, with 21-25 tines and a central role in their religion, helping people keep in contact with the ancestors.
